Upkeep can change your whole maintenance program

It's as good at the information provided, which is made better because once it's in there, its accessible to anyone and over time, can provide information

Pros

Information, details, knowing what was done on a machine last time, it means that you don't necessarily have to do the same job twice. If a problem comes back and was misdiagnosed last time you can review what was done and see if you can find where the actual issue is.

Locations, parts, assets, you can put them all into this software and down to the bolt you can provide details on any of them.

Cons

The UI needs work, especially when moving parts around or finding assets in a location. Having a naming standard helps a lot. If you know that an item belongs at a specific site, having a clear site name along with what it is makes a difference.

Perfect CMMS for my Needs

Using Upkeep has been an easy process, and it helps keep everything in one place. I also like the fact that our Operations Manager sees everything that I do, from creation of work orders, to updates, and completion of work orders.

Pros

The free features are perfect for my use. My day is all about work orders, and being able to manage these work orders easily makes my day easier. We used to use paper work orders, which I had to fill out, file, and then track in another file. I would then need to create a separate report to send to the property team for review. I like having the ability to have everything in one place, without having to create so many separate reports.

Cons

Nothing about this software is difficult to use. I do wish more was offered in the free version, such as reporting. I was able to use it during the free trial, but now am using the free version, in which reporting is only available in paid versions. I understand that this is how the company makes money, and I will be making the switch to a paid version when it is approved in our new budget.

One thing that bugs me and hope gets fixed, is during the work order creation. I have over 120 locations and sub-locations. When I create a work order and choose the location, you should be able to begin typing the location in the box and it should self-populate the box. Right now, only the main locations will self-populate, not the sub-locations. I only have three main locations, and all the rest are sub-locations, so I have to scroll to search for the exact location I need. It's nothing major, but just an annoyance, and I hope this will be fixed soon so that any location will self-populate the box when you begin typing it.

Alternatives Considered

MAPCON and ManWinWin

Reasons for Switching to UpKeep

Pricing was better for what you get. ManWinWin was way to technical, and made more for factories. Mapcon may have worked and it seemed to be pretty user-friendly as well, and I did try their free trial, but it kept crashing my computer every single time.

Great for our medium sized business!

Overall UpKeep is a great piece of software that continues to improve with regular feature updates. I would recommend it to anyone managing a medium to large sized business facility or multiple properties.

Pros

UpKeep is a great service for managing work orders, tracking assets and scheduling your teams time. The request portal and phone app make it easy for our managers to submit maintenance requests and for our maintenance team to prioritize and respond in a timely fashion. The asset system is great for tracking parts and preventative and reactive maintenance that has been performed on individual items such as HVAC units. The Ability to upload pictures and other files such as repair manuals, to work orders and assets is also a huge plus. All around UpKeep is a great piece of software that I would recommend to anyone with a medium to large size business or anyone managing multiple properties.

Cons

UpKeep offers the ability to generate PDF invoices to submit to clients however there is no way to save or return to a generated invoice within the software; once the invoice is exported as PDF and you close the window you can no longer return. I would love to see an invoicing feature that is more similar to the work order system. As a country club we not only track our internal maintenance, but maintenance performed on members golf carts and other items. The ability to generate invoices more fluidly would be much better than having to utilize an integration. I'm also disappointed that the ability to track additional costs related to a work order are only offered in the business plus plan, rather than the professional or starter plans. There are many times where I want to add an individual expense with a description attached to it, without having to input it in the parts and inventory section.

UpKeep for a Multiple Facility Manufacturer

This the first full CMMS our organization has ever used.
UpKeep was chosen after trying a number of CMMS systems against some basic goals.
UpKeep is competent, easy to implement, easy to use and has the best Customer Service team

Pros

The customer service is the best! Fast and competent replies to issues and feature requests.
Ease of use for everybody. Setup and maintaining the system was intensive since we have over 1000 assets spread out over 6 locations and 13 buildings and UpKeep is fast, easy and simple build the database with. The template uploads helped get us going and the inline editing was a great addition.

Cons

The "View Only" account is a free account. Since we have nearly 50 supervisors and leads, this free account could be the answer for communication and information. They can see open work orders so that they don't double a request. They can see the Preventive Maintenance calendar to plan their production around servicing of the machines. They can see the performance of the maintenance team in their departments. They can do reports. They can see everything.
The problem is if one of these "View Only" users submits a work request, they cannot comment on the work order. Commenting on ones work order is only allowed on the free "Requester" account or the paid accounts.
At first this wasn't much of a deterrent but having to call or send email to maintenance after submitting a request into UpKeep just to make a comment is tedious when the comment section is already in a work order.
It is even worse on mobile because it will let a person type a comment only to pop up a flag saying this is not allowed when pressing "Send". There have been a few frustrated users at this point.

UpKeep Review for Condo Association Application

My work experience primarily dealt with using large, enterprise-type systems. I was surprised to find that UpKeep provided features as standard that large systems charged thousands of dollars for. For example, in our association, we can now bring the community of owners into the maintenance effort with work requests accessed from a cell phone or email. This has greatly improved our maintenance effort when it comes to maintenance needs that our typically found by owners. This has greatly improved that morale and attitude the owner population. Also, board members can now keep track of what work is being done and what vendors are following our standards. We have been using UpKeep for about 8 months and quite happy with the results so far. We hope to do even better in the coming year.

Pros

The software is very competitive when it comes to cost. We looked at many software options before deciding on UpKeep. For price and performance, it was the best value out there.

Cons

Developing an asset hierarchy/equipment tree can be cumbersome. When creating a hierarchy, I would like to be able to put my assets in an order that makes sense to me. It is difficult to do this with UpKeep unless you use some trick such as inserting a letter or character in front of the asset. Also, I don't like that a a just-completed PM triggers the immediate creation of the next PM in my backlog. That is, when a quarterly PM is completed, the next scheduled PM immediately appears in my backlog of work. Don't want this to appear until a week or two before, but this is not possible. So, have to work around that.

UpKeep CMMS Software

Pros

UpKeep is a lightweight CMMS solution that is accessible via web browser or dedicated Android and iOS apps. It is easy to tell that UpKeep was built with a mobile-first viewpoint. This is when comparing to other CMMS solutions that have been adapted from desktop to mobile.

This mobile-first outlook makes UpKeep extremely user friendly. The ease of use allows our maintenance techs to prioritize, dispatch, update, and complete work orders from the shop floor on their mobile devices.

It is pretty quick to add work orders and tie the to specific assets. PM is a large part of our maintenance program and UpKeep's PM system is straightforward and simple without lacking depth.

Cons

Being a lighter-weight software solution, I feel there is a small sacrifice between depth of the solution and ease of use (and price). UpKeep is very affordable but I would like to see more connections and options, especially when linking Assets to Repeat (PM) Work Orders.
